At the bottom of the mid-Atlantic ocean, a dusty leather suitcase sits on the sand as fish slowly swim by. Surrounded by mangled, corroded wreckage from the Titanic, you wouldn’t notice it unless you looked hard.
It belonged to William Harbeck, a cinematographer onboard the fated maiden voyage of the Titanic in 1912. At 12,500ft below the sea, the film inside will never be recovered.
Except the leather suitcase isn’t real.
